### Step 6 — Archive Cold Buckets

Before sign-off, make sure the Frostbin archiver is actually pointed at the cold tier. Set `FROSTBIN_TIER=glacial` and `FROSTBIN_RETENTION_DAYS=365` — last quarter someone left it on `warm` and we paid triple for storage nobody touched. The archiver scans buckets tagged `cold:true`, compresses them, and ships manifests to the Hollowmere vault. Dry-run first with `FROSTBIN_DRY_RUN=true` and eyeball the manifest. The vault requires signed requests, so the env file needs this line added:

sealed setting: ARCHIVE_KEY3=8d0

Subject: Handover — Proseguard linter database

For whoever maintains this next: Proseguard, our documentation linter, stores rule definitions, suppression records, and per-repo scan history in a single relational database. The nightly vacuum job is scheduled at 02:00 and must not overlap the scan-history rollup, or you'll see lock contention — I've documented the ordering in the ops notes. Backups run hourly to the cold archive. If you need to inspect the schema or run maintenance queries directly, connect using the connection string below.

primary connection of yagep-kahip = redis://giliel_svc:zYiKsLL2PLpfPL@db-348f.xolmarsys.corp:5432/fenwyn

09:47 — Traces from the Willowbend checkout service stopped propagating span context into the Ferrous inventory service after its proxy upgrade, leaving the Quince dashboard showing orphaned spans. The team confirmed the header rewrite dropped the trace parent field. Reviewers should note the fix landed in the build identified by the token below.

build token for fajof-yahof: htk4_869f

Welcome to FeedCheck, our podcast feed validator at Quillcast. You'll mostly touch the lint rules in `rules/` and the RSS parser. Local setup: clone the repo, run `make bootstrap`, then `make test`. The validator calls our internal MetaStore service for episode dedup checks, so you'll need credentials before anything passes CI. Your key for the staging MetaStore instance is below.

API key for hahag-kafof: vxb3-kck